  • Abstract
    In discrete-time Networked Control Systems (NCSs), playback buffers turn network delays into time-invariant quantities but at the potential expense of increased packet losses and delays, which can destabilize the closed-loop system. We define a class of model-based control schemes and prove stability of the closed-loop system under arbitrary connectivity patterns. We also characterize their impulse response and behavior under bounded disturbances.
